| Commit message (Expand) | Author | Age |
* | Instructiosn with 1 memory operand have 4 operands in our | Alkis Evlogimenos | 2004-02-17 |
* | Align case statements. | Alkis Evlogimenos | 2004-02-17 |
* | Add TEST and XCHG memory operand support. | Alkis Evlogimenos | 2004-02-17 |
* | Add OR and XOR memory operand support. | Alkis Evlogimenos | 2004-02-17 |
* | Peephole optimize SUBmi{16,32} into SUBmi{16,32}b when immediate is 8 | Alkis Evlogimenos | 2004-02-17 |
* | ADDmi{16,32} should be in the next case statement. | Alkis Evlogimenos | 2004-02-17 |
* | Add memory operand folding support for MUL, DIV, IDIV, NEG, NOT, | Alkis Evlogimenos | 2004-02-17 |
* | Add memory operand folding for CMP{rm,mr,mi}{8,16,32}, INCm{8,16,32} | Alkis Evlogimenos | 2004-02-17 |
* | Add CMP{rm,mr,mi}{8,16,32}, INCm{8,16,32} and DECm{8,16,32} instructions. | Alkis Evlogimenos | 2004-02-17 |
* | Add SUB{rm,mr,mi}{8,16,32} instructions. | Alkis Evlogimenos | 2004-02-17 |
* | Add support to the local allocator for fusing spill code into the instructions | Chris Lattner | 2004-02-17 |
* | Add support for folding memory operands for ADC, SBB and SUB instructions. | Alkis Evlogimenos | 2004-02-17 |
* | Add support for ADC{rm.mr}32 and SBB{rm,mr}32. | Alkis Evlogimenos | 2004-02-17 |
* | Add a (hidden) option to print instructions that fail to fuse. It's looking | Chris Lattner | 2004-02-17 |
* | Add support for folding memory operands in MOVri{8,16,32} instructions. | Alkis Evlogimenos | 2004-02-17 |
* | Expand the repertoire of the forms we can print and encode. | Chris Lattner | 2004-02-17 |
* | Disable this peephole for now. We can't keep track of the fact that the imme... | Chris Lattner | 2004-02-17 |
* | Fix a bug in my previous refactoring change... arg! | Chris Lattner | 2004-02-17 |
* | The C backend is no longer in llvm-dis, it's in llc | Chris Lattner | 2004-02-17 |
* | Add an option to disable spill fusing in the X86 backend | Chris Lattner | 2004-02-17 |
* | Fix the mneumonics for the mov instructions to have the source and destination | Chris Lattner | 2004-02-17 |
* | Fix the last crimes against nature that used the 'ir' ordering to use the | Chris Lattner | 2004-02-17 |
* | GRRR. Move instructions have swapped the order of the r/m operands. | Chris Lattner | 2004-02-17 |
* | Rename MOVi[mr] instructions to MOV[rm]i | Chris Lattner | 2004-02-17 |
* | Whoops, got my cases swapped. | Chris Lattner | 2004-02-17 |
* | Change to match the newer, simpler, interface | Chris Lattner | 2004-02-17 |
* | Add support for folding memory operands into AND and IMUL's | Chris Lattner | 2004-02-17 |
* | Scrunchify code, by adding helpers. No functionality changes. | Chris Lattner | 2004-02-17 |
* | Add mem forms of AND instructions | Chris Lattner | 2004-02-17 |
* | Add LiveIntervals::Interval::empty() member function. | Alkis Evlogimenos | 2004-02-17 |
* | Add API to check and fold memory operands into instructions. | Alkis Evlogimenos | 2004-02-17 |
* | Rename the IMULri* instructions to IMULrri, as they are actually three address | Chris Lattner | 2004-02-17 |
* | Once we have a way to fold spill code reloads into instructions, we have a wa... | Chris Lattner | 2004-02-17 |
* | Fix spilled interval update. It was too conservative. | Alkis Evlogimenos | 2004-02-17 |
* | Refactor code a bit. No functionality changes, though the comment hints at t... | Chris Lattner | 2004-02-17 |
* | Adjust to recent changes | Chris Lattner | 2004-02-17 |
* | Add peephole optimizations for ADD [MEM], IMM8 instructions. | Alkis Evlogimenos | 2004-02-16 |
* | Add two more variants of add. Update comments. | Alkis Evlogimenos | 2004-02-16 |
* | Only spit out warning for functions that take pointers, not for sin and the like | Chris Lattner | 2004-02-16 |
* | Move the folding of gep null, 0, 0, 0 to a place where it can be shared and | Chris Lattner | 2004-02-16 |
* | memset and bcopy and now unified by the llvm.memset intrinsic | Chris Lattner | 2004-02-16 |
* | Add some ADD instructions that take memory operands for Alkis | Chris Lattner | 2004-02-16 |
* | Add LeakDetection to MachineInstr. | Alkis Evlogimenos | 2004-02-16 |
* | Implement test/Regression/Transforms/SimplifyCFG/UncondBranchToReturn.ll, | Chris Lattner | 2004-02-16 |
* | Fold PHI nodes of constants which are only used by a single cast. This imple... | Chris Lattner | 2004-02-16 |
* | Teach LLVM to unravel the "swap idiom". This implements: | Chris Lattner | 2004-02-16 |
* | Implement Transforms/InstCombine/xor.ll:test19 | Chris Lattner | 2004-02-16 |
* | Fix a bug in the recent rewrite of the leakdetector that caused all of the | Chris Lattner | 2004-02-15 |
* | Now that the lowerinvoke pass inserts calls to llvm.setjmp/llvm.longjmp, some | Chris Lattner | 2004-02-15 |
* | By default, llvm.setjmp/llvm.longjmp intrinsics get lowered to their libc cou... | Chris Lattner | 2004-02-15 |